But, if your story installment is pretty big (100k or more) it might be
worth considering sending it as an attachment so that the FFML isn't
flooded with several chunks of your story. It could be argued that sending
a 100k attachment is the same thing as sending several pieces of your story
installment when comparing file sizes, but I have noticed that people seem
to take offense more to the several pieces method. The sheer jump in
quantity of emails can be over whelming and instinctively annoying.

  There is a simple reason why people have a tendancy to dislike split
files..
there is no guarantee that all of the parts will make it through.  I've
even
seen this happen on R.A.A.C itself, where a part to a story has not
appeared on
my server.  On a mailing list, things may be different but old habits
are hard to
break.

  Anyone who creates large stories should seriously consider getting
free web based space and point people to the location of the story.  I
